I uninstalled and reinstalled python yesterday, in case that was a source of
problems, and I added the python-devel and python-tools just in case (which
required tcl/tk).
Mailman since 2.1.9 has required Python 2.3.x or newer.
The implementation of Sibling Lists in Mailman 2.1.11 actually uses
Python sets which requires at least Python 2.4.x, but I think if you
don't configure any regular_incluse_lists or regular_exclude_lists,
you are OK with Python 2.3.x.
